A Dutch guy decided to name his son Nxt (pronounced 'Next') because he would be 'part of the next generation'. Unfortunately the father couldn't register his child because the government argued 'Nxt' was not an actual name (I honestly didn't know we had naming laws here). The result? The kid is now called:

Depp Nxt Borrel

...with Borrel being the last name. They say they didn't choose Depp because of Johnny Depp, so I have no clue why they did.

Borrel is the Dutch word for 'Drink' (as in, alcoholic drink) so needless to say I think this name is beyond awful.
